What is a Tweet Scraper

2024-07-13 04:00

Proxy4Free

I. Introduction


1. What is a tweet scraper?
A tweet scraper is a tool or software that allows users to extract and collect data from Twitter. It can retrieve specific information from tweets such as hashtags, keywords, usernames, and other relevant data.

2. Why do you need a tweet scraper?
There are several reasons why you may need a tweet scraper. Firstly, it can help you gather valuable insights and data for market research, competitor analysis, or social media monitoring purposes. It allows you to analyze trends, sentiments, and user behavior on Twitter.

Additionally, a tweet scraper can be useful for journalists, researchers, or businesses looking to gather information for their reports, articles, or academic studies. It provides a way to collect and analyze large amounts of data efficiently.

3. What core benefits do tweet scraper offer in terms of security, stability, and anonymity?
a. Security: A tweet scraper can ensure data security by providing encryption or secure protocols to prevent unauthorized access to the extracted data. This helps protect sensitive information and ensures compliance with privacy regulations.

b. Stability: Tweet scrapers are designed to handle large volumes of data extraction and can perform this task consistently and reliably. They are capable of handling server errors, network interruptions, and other issues that may arise during the scraping process.

c. Anonymity: Tweet scrapers offer the advantage of anonymity by masking your IP address or using proxy servers. This helps protect your identity while collecting data, especially if you are monitoring competitors or conducting research. Anonymity also prevents Twitter from blocking your account or restricting your access due to excessive scraping.

Overall, the core benefits of a tweet scraper in terms of security, stability, and anonymity make it a valuable tool for data extraction and analysis from Twitter.

II. Advantages of tweet scraper


A. How Do tweet scrapers Bolster Security?

1. Tweet scrapers contribute to online security by enabling users to monitor and analyze public tweets without direct interaction with the Twitter platform. This reduces the risk of exposing personal information or being targeted by malicious actors on the platform.

2. To protect personal data, tweet scrapers often offer features such as data encryption, secure connections (HTTPS), and the ability to store data locally rather than on external servers. Additionally, reputable tweet scraper providers implement strict privacy policies and comply with data protection regulations to ensure the security of user data.

B. Why Do tweet scrapers Ensure Unwavering Stability?

1. Tweet scrapers act as a solution for maintaining a consistent internet connection by providing uninterrupted access to Twitter data. They can handle large volumes of tweets and maintain continuous data scraping even during peak usage periods or network disruptions.

2. Stability is crucial when using tweet scrapers for specific online tasks such as sentiment analysis, real-time monitoring of events, or tracking trends. Any interruption or downtime can result in incomplete or inaccurate data, which may hinder the effectiveness of these tasks.

C. How Do tweet scrapers Uphold Anonymity?

1. Yes, tweet scrapers can help achieve anonymity to some extent. They allow users to scrape and analyze tweets without directly interacting with Twitter. This means that users can access and collect public tweets without revealing their identity or leaving a digital footprint on the platform.

However, it is important to note that while tweet scrapers may provide anonymity in terms of not requiring direct interaction with Twitter, they do not guarantee complete anonymity. Users must still adhere to data protection laws and ethical guidelines when using tweet scrapers to ensure the privacy of individuals mentioned in the scraped tweets.

III. Selecting the Right tweet scraper Provider


A. Why is tweet scraper Provider Reputation Essential?

1. Assessing and identifying reputable tweet scraper providers is crucial because it ensures the reliability and credibility of the service. A reputable provider is more likely to have a proven track record of delivering accurate and high-quality data, as well as maintaining the security and privacy of their clients' information.

B. How does pricing for tweet scraper impact decision-making?

1. The pricing structure of tweet scraper providers can significantly influence decision-making. Higher prices may indicate better quality and more advanced features, but it's important to carefully consider the specific needs and budget of your project. Cheaper options may still provide adequate functionality for some users.

2. To achieve a balance between tweet scraper cost and quality, it is essential to conduct thorough research and compare different providers. Consider the features included in each pricing plan, such as data volume, real-time updates, and customer support. It is also wise to read reviews and testimonials to get insight into the experiences of other users.

C. What role does geographic location selection play when using a tweet scraper?

1. Selecting a tweet scraper provider with diverse geographic locations can benefit various online activities. By accessing data from different regions, users can gain a more comprehensive and accurate understanding of global trends, opinions, and user behavior on Twitter. This diversity can be particularly useful for businesses targeting international markets or conducting market research on a global scale.

D. How does customer support affect the reliability when using a tweet scraper?

1. Customer support quality is a crucial factor in evaluating the reliability of a tweet scraper provider. Look for providers that offer responsive and knowledgeable customer support, preferably 24/7. This ensures that any technical issues or questions can be addressed promptly, minimizing downtime and optimizing the overall experience.

Guidelines for evaluating customer service quality include checking if the provider offers multiple support channels (e.g., email, live chat, phone), assessing their response time, and researching the provider's reputation for customer satisfaction. It's also helpful to review any available documentation or guides that the provider offers to determine the level of support they provide to their users.

In conclusion, when selecting a tweet scraper provider, it is essential to consider their reputation, pricing structure, geographic location selection, and customer support quality. These factors will contribute to the reliability, accuracy, and overall success of your tweet scraping activities.

IV. Setup and Configuration


A. How to Install Tweet Scraper?

1. General Steps for Installing Tweet Scraper:
Installing a tweet scraper involves a few general steps:

a. Choose a Platform: Decide whether you want to install the tweet scraper on your local machine or a server.

b. Install Python: Make sure Python is installed on your machine or server. You can download the latest version of Python from the official website and follow the installation instructions.

c. Install Required Dependencies: Tweet scraper usually requires specific libraries and dependencies. The most common ones are requests, BeautifulSoup, and Selenium. You can install them using pip, the Python package manager.

d. Download the Tweet Scraper: Clone or download the tweet scraper code from the official repository, if it's available. You can find the repository link and instructions on the developer's website or GitHub page.

e. Set Up Configuration: Before running the tweet scraper, you may need to configure certain settings such as API keys, authentication tokens, and search parameters. Refer to the documentation or readme file provided with the tweet scraper for guidance on how to set up the configuration.

f. Run the Tweet Scraper: Once the dependencies are installed and the configuration is set up, you can run the tweet scraper by executing the appropriate command in your terminal or command prompt.

2. Software or Tools Required for Installation:
To install tweet scraper, you generally need the following software or tools:

a. Python: Make sure you have the latest version of Python installed on your machine or server.

b. Pip: Pip is the default package manager for Python. It allows you to install third-party libraries and dependencies easily. Ensure that pip is installed along with Python.

c. Git (optional): If the tweet scraper is available on a git repository, you might need to have Git installed to clone the repository and download the code.

B. How to Configure Tweet Scraper?

1. Primary Configuration Options and Settings:
The primary configuration options and settings for tweet scraper may include:

a. API Credentials: To access Twitter's data, you'll typically need API credentials, which consist of an API key, API secret key, access token, and access token secret. These credentials should be obtained from the Twitter Developer platform and configured in the tweet scraper settings.

b. Search Parameters: Specify the search parameters, such as keywords, hashtags, usernames, or specific dates, to retrieve relevant tweets. These parameters determine the type of tweets the scraper will collect.

c. Output Format: Determine the format in which you want the scraped tweets to be saved. Options may include CSV, JSON, or a database. Configure the output format to suit your requirements.

2. Proxy Settings Optimization:
Depending on your use case, optimizing proxy settings can help improve the performance and efficiency of tweet scraper. Here are some recommendations:

a. Rotating Proxies: Consider using rotating proxies to avoid IP blocks or rate limitations from Twitter. Rotating proxies allow the scraper to switch between different IP addresses, enhancing anonymity and preventing excessive requests from a single IP.

b. Proxy Pool: Utilize a proxy pool to have a large pool of IP addresses available for the tweet scraper to use. This ensures that even if some proxies are blocked, there are still others to continue the scraping process smoothly.

c. Proxy Authentication: If your proxies require authentication, make sure to configure the scraper with the appropriate proxy credentials.

Remember to follow the terms of service and guidelines provided by Twitter while using proxies with tweet scraper to ensure compliance.

In summary, installing tweet scraper involves setting up Python, installing dependencies, and downloading the code. Configuration options include API credentials, search parameters, and output format. Optimizing proxy settings can enhance performance and prevent IP blocks.

V. Best Practices


A. How to Use tweet scraper Responsibly?

1. Ethical considerations and legal responsibilities:
When using a tweet scraper, it is important to be aware of ethical considerations and legal responsibilities to ensure responsible usage. Some key points to consider include:

- Respect user privacy: Avoid scraping personal or sensitive information without consent. It is important to comply with privacy laws and regulations in your jurisdiction.
- Follow the terms of service: Understand and adhere to the terms of service of the platform you are scraping tweets from. Violating these terms can lead to legal consequences.
- Avoid spam and harassment: Do not use tweet scraper for spamming or harassment purposes. Respect other users' rights and avoid engaging in malicious activities.
- Attribute content properly: If you use scraped tweets for any public use, make sure to attribute the original content to the respective users.

2. Guidelines for responsible and ethical proxy usage with tweet scraper:
Using proxies with tweet scraper can help maintain anonymity and prevent IP blocking. Here are some guidelines for responsible and ethical proxy usage:

- Use legitimate proxy providers: Choose reputable proxy providers that comply with legal and ethical standards. Avoid using proxies from unreliable or unethical sources.
- Do not abuse proxies: Use proxies responsibly and avoid overloading them with excessive requests. Respect the proxy provider's terms of service and usage limits.
- Rotate proxies: Regularly rotate and switch between different proxies to distribute the load and prevent suspicions of scraping activity.
- Monitor proxy performance: Keep track of proxy performance and ensure they are functioning properly. Replace any proxies that are not working or are flagged for suspicious activity.

B. How to Monitor and Maintain tweet scraper?

1. Importance of regular monitoring and maintenance:
Regular monitoring and maintenance of tweet scraper are crucial for several reasons:

- Ensure reliable data: By monitoring the scraper, you can identify and resolve any issues that may affect the quality or accuracy of the scraped tweets.
- Prevent downtime: Regular maintenance helps identify potential issues before they cause significant disruptions, ensuring continuous operation of the scraper.
- Optimize performance: Monitoring allows you to identify bottlenecks or areas for improvement, enabling you to optimize the scraper's performance and efficiency.

2. Best practices for troubleshooting common issues with tweet scraper:

- Check network connectivity: Verify that your internet connection is stable and there are no network issues that could affect the scraper's performance.
- Verify API credentials: Ensure that the API credentials used by the scraper are valid and up to date. Incorrect credentials can cause authentication failures.
- Monitor error logs: Keep an eye on the error logs generated by the scraper. These logs often provide valuable insights into the cause of issues and can guide troubleshooting efforts.
- Update dependencies: Regularly check for updates to the software or libraries used by the scraper. Outdated dependencies can lead to compatibility issues or security vulnerabilities.
- Implement error handling: Include robust error handling mechanisms in your scraper to gracefully handle unexpected errors or issues encountered during the scraping process.

Regularly implementing these best practices will help maintain the stability and performance of your tweet scraper.

VI. Conclusion


1. The primary advantages of using a tweet scraper are:

a) Data collection: Tweet scrapers allow users to gather large amounts of data from Twitter, including tweets, user profiles, hashtags, and more. This data can be used for various purposes like research, sentiment analysis, trend analysis, and market intelligence.

b) Real-time monitoring: With a tweet scraper, you can track specific keywords, hashtags, or user accounts to get real-time updates on relevant tweets. This is valuable for staying updated on breaking news, industry trends, or monitoring brand mentions.

c) Customization: Tweet scrapers offer flexibility in terms of the specific data you want to collect. You can specify search criteria, filters, and parameters to narrow down the data to your specific needs.

d) Automation: Tweet scrapers automate the data collection process, saving time and effort. Instead of manually searching for tweets, the scraper does it for you, ensuring a constant stream of data.

2. Final recommendations and tips for using a tweet scraper:

a) Choose a reliable provider: When selecting a tweet scraper provider, consider factors like reputation, customer reviews, and support services. Look for one that offers regular updates and maintenance to ensure compatibility with Twitter's APIs.

b) Understand and comply with Twitter's terms of service: Familiarize yourself with Twitter's policies and guidelines for API usage. Ensure that your scraper is within the allowed limits and doesn't violate any rules.

c) Maintain data privacy and security: If you're dealing with sensitive data, make sure your tweet scraper provider has robust security measures in place to protect your information. This includes encryption, secure data storage, and adherence to data protection regulations.

d) Optimize your scraper: To maximize the efficiency of your tweet scraper, consider using multiple threads or proxies to handle large amounts of data. Monitor the scraper's performance regularly and make necessary adjustments to improve speed and accuracy.

3. Encouraging readers to make informed decisions:

a) Provide a comparison of different tweet scraper providers: Compare the features, pricing, and customer reviews of different providers to help readers choose one that suits their needs.

b) Highlight the importance of research: Emphasize the significance of researching and evaluating different tweet scraper options before making a purchase. This includes reading user testimonials, checking for trial versions, and considering the reputation of the provider.

c) Discuss the potential limitations and risks: Inform readers about the potential limitations, such as rate limits imposed by Twitter, and the risks associated with violating Twitter's terms of service. Encourage readers to weigh these factors carefully before investing in a tweet scraper.

d) Offer a step-by-step guide for setting up and configuring a tweet scraper: Provide a detailed guide on how to set up and configure a tweet scraper, including tips for optimizing its performance and ensuring compliance with Twitter's guidelines.

By providing readers with comprehensive information, tips, and recommendations, they can make an informed decision when considering the purchase of a tweet scraper.